What is an organisation identifier?
An organisation identifier is a unique piece of text that definitively identifies an organisation.
Examples include charity numbers and company numbers.
Identifiers are usually assigned by an external body like a regulator.
Findthatcharity uses the Org ID scheme to create identifiers.
GB-CHC gives the scheme for this identifier (Charity Commission), while 1158958 is the identifier for this organisation within the scheme.
Description
The objects of the cio are to relieve sickness and poverty:(a) by developing health policy and models of care and delivery of health services in low and middle income countries. (b) by providing and commissioning education, research and training opportunities in the united kingdom and low and middle income countries.(c) by offering and organising volunteering opportunities for the benefit of patients and medical students in the united kingdom and low and middle income countries.
